AYNOR ELEMENTARY SCHOOL

Aynor Elementary is a public elementary school that is part of the Horry 01 school district, located in Aynor, SC with about 872 students offering grade levels from Pre-Kindergarten to 5th Grade. Student demographics can be found below. With about 53 teachers, Aynor Elementary has a student/teacher ratio of about 16: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

Aynor Elementary School, located on Jordanville Road in Aynor, South Carolina, serves as a cornerstone of the close-knit Aynor community. As part of the Horry County School District, the school is well-regarded for its emphasis on fostering a supportive, small-town atmosphere that encourages academic growth and personal development for students in their formative years. The school is known for its strong community involvement and the "Blue Jacket" spirit, which reflects a deep sense of local pride and tradition.

Beyond its focus on core academic subjects, Aynor Elementary prioritizes the development of the "whole child" by incorporating character education and community engagement into the daily school experience. The campus serves as a central hub for families in the rural Aynor area, providing a stable, nurturing environment that prepares students for the transition to middle school while maintaining high expectations for citizenship and scholastic achievement.

* A public charter school is a publicly funded school that is typically governed by a group or organization under a legislative contract with the state, the district, or another entity. The charter exempts the school from certain state or local rules and regulations.

1 The National School Lunch Program (NSLP) provides eligible students with free or reduced-price lunch

2 Title I, Part A (Title I) of the Elementary and Secondary Education Act prov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families.
